本文将深入探讨在使用v2ray进行环境准备时可能出现的错误。v2ray是一个强大的网络工具,可以用于科学上网,但在配置过程中,用户可能会遇到各种问题。本文将帮助你理解这些错误,并提供有效的解决方案。
v2ray简介
v2ray是一款可以在多种平台上运行的代理工具,支持多种协议和功能。它的灵活性和可扩展性使其成为网络访问的理想选择。
为什么会出现环境准备错误?
在准备v2ray环境时,可能会遇到如下问题:
- 依赖未安装:一些必须依赖的库没有安装。
- 版本不兼容:系统环境或v2ray版本不符合要求。
- 网络问题:无法连接到必要的资源。
- 权限问题:缺乏足够的权限来进行安装。
环境准备步骤
在使用v2ray之前,确保你的服务器环境符合以下要求:
- 操作系统
- 推荐使用Ubuntu或CentOS等Linux系统。
- 更新系统
- 在Ubuntu上运行
sudo apt update && sudo apt upgrade
- 在CentOS上运行
sudo yum update
- 在Ubuntu上运行
- 安装基础工具
- 安装
git
和wget
:sudo apt install git wget
或sudo yum install git wget
- 安装
常见的v2ray准备环境错误
1. 依赖库未安装
问题描述:在准备过程中,出现缺少某些依赖库的提示。
解决方案:根据提示安装缺失的库。例如,运行: bash sudo apt install libc6 libstdc++6
2. v2ray版本不兼容
问题描述:安装的v2ray版本与操作系统不兼容。
解决方案:使用官方文档确认支持的版本,按照官方版本进行下载安装。
3. 网络连接失败
问题描述:在下载v2ray时,出现连接失败的提示。
解决方案:检查网络连接,确保可以访问互联网。使用命令 ping google.com
检查网络。
4. 权限不足
问题描述:在安装或配置过程中返回权限不足信息。
解决方案:在执行安装命令时加上sudo
前缀,或切换至根用户。
v2ray环境准备的最佳实践
- 定期更新:保持系统及v2ray更新,确保使用最新的功能和安全补丁。
- 备份配置:在进行重大更改之前,备份配置文件。
- 网络检查:定期检查网络连接状况,避免中断对使用的影响。
FAQ
如何检查v2ray是否安装成功?
您可以通过运行以下命令来检查v2ray的版本: bash v2ray -version
如果看到版本信息,则表示安装成功。
v2ray和vmess有关吗?
是的,vmess是v2ray使用的协议之一。v2ray支持包括vmess在内的多种协议。
我如何解决v2ray启动失败的问题?
首先查看v2ray的日志文件,位于 /var/log/v2ray/
。检查错误信息,并根据提示调整配置。
哪里可以找到v2ray的最新版本?
您可以访问v2ray的GitHub页面以获取最新版本及更新日志。
结论
在使用v2ray时,准备环境是一个重要的步骤。为避免常见的错误,用户应仔细检查系统要求、网络连接及权限设置等。通过本文所述的错误解决方案,用户能够更顺利地完成v2ray的安装与配置,从而体验到高效的网络访问。